About (3S,8E,14R,17S,18R,20S)-14-(hydroxymethyl)-3,19,19-trimethyl-1-azatricyclo[15.4.0.018,20]henicos-8-ene-2,16-dione

(3S,8E,14R,17S,18R,20S)-14-(hydroxymethyl)-3,19,19-trimethyl-1-azatricyclo[15.4.0.018,20]henicos-8-ene-2,16-dione (PubChem CID 58311157) has the molecular formula C24H39NO3 and a molecular weight of 389.58 g/mol. Its IUPAC name is (3S,8E,14R,17S,18R,20S)-14-(hydroxymethyl)-3,19,19-trimethyl-1-azatricyclo[15.4.0.018,20]henicos-8-ene-2,16-dione.
